Transaction bb24436ee79c540528dcde144333687115f798897c92a0cd11f5c3d27bfc65ac
1 Input
1 Output
-
bb24436ee79c540528dcde144333687115f798897c92a0cd11f5c3d27bfc65ac:0
- value
- 833807
- script pubkey
- OP_0 OP_PUSHBYTES_32 1f22b863fd253ab9c6e2e7ce8dbb3bcf345348a01bc2621b305c01aa7dd9da99
- address
- bc1qru3tsclay5atn3hzul8gmwemeu69xj9qr0pxyxestsq65lwem2vsjf70rj